Abstract
The inferior alveolar nerve courses anteriorly within the mandibular canal, providing sensory nerve supply to the mandibular teeth, the buccal mucosa, the gingiva, and the soft tissues of the lower lip and chin. To avoid damage to this nerve and resulting sensory disturbances, its exact location must be known before placement of a dental implant. Imaging modalities currently used to visualize the position of the inferior alveolar nerve may be inaccurate. This study was undertaken to determine the accuracy of micro-computed tomography (micro-CT) for determining the position of this nerve.
